Album Notes

’Devil’s Secrets’ is the highly anticipated all-original release from Nigel Mack, ‘Canada’s Blues Ambassador to Chicago’. It is the third album by the blues multi-instrumentalist and singer, following his two critically acclaimed CDs 'Road Rage' and ‘High Price To Play.’

‘Devil’s Secrets’ features many different blues styles, from horn laden R&B and juke-joint harmonica instrumentals, to New Orleans funk and Chicago style blues. It chronicles Nigel move from Vancouver Canada to Chicago, IL in 2003. An all-star cast of top musicians from both countries (including special guest CJ Chennier) reflects his years of touring as a bandleader and his dedication as a record producer.

‘Devil’s Secrets’ was tracked at Joyride Studios in Chicago, IL (with Grammy award-winning engineer Blaise Barton), Blue Wave studios in Vancouver, BC and was mixed by award-winning engineer Perry Barrett in Nashville TN. It is the third album produced by Nigel Mack, with a sharp eye toward high production values, while still embracing the honesty of the blues.
